Sec. 775.026. CONVERSION OF RURAL FIRE PREVENTION DISTRICTS TO EMERGENCY SERVICES DISTRICTS.

(a)Each rural fire prevention district created under former Chapter 794 is converted to an emergency services district operating under this chapter.
(b)The name of a district converted under this section is changed to "___ Emergency Services District No. ___," with the name of the county or counties in which the district is located and an appropriate number inserted to distinguish one district from another district.
(c)The emergency services district to which a rural fire prevention district converts assumes all obligations and outstanding indebtedness of the rural fire prevention district.
